COLUMBIA -- Continental Airlines is now charging for extra leg room.
The airline is the latest carrier to start selling unreserved economy seats with extra legroom.
The price for the seats depends on the length of the flight, the market, and other factors.
You'll get a minimum of seven inches of extra leg space.
Continental will start selling the unreserved coach seats on March 17.
Members of the One-Pass Elite Frequent Flier Program will not be charged.
Continental Airlines serves Columbia Metro Airport.
